Understanding Invisalign

Invisalign is a modern and popular alternative to traditional braces for straightening teeth. In this section, we will explore how Invisalign works, its benefits, and its effectiveness.

Invisalign utilizes a series of clear, removable aligners that are custom-made to fit your teeth. These aligners gradually and gently shift your teeth into the desired position. Every few weeks, you will switch to a new set of aligners, each one designed to continue the progress made by the previous set.

One of the key benefits of Invisalign braces is their discreet appearance. The aligners are virtually invisible, making them a great choice for individuals who wish to straighten their teeth without drawing attention to their orthodontic treatment. Unlike traditional braces, there are no metal brackets or wires to worry about, which means no irritation to the cheeks and gums.

In addition to its aesthetic advantages, Invisalign offers several other benefits. The aligners are removable, allowing you to enjoy your favorite foods without restrictions. You can also brush and floss your teeth normally, promoting better oral hygiene during your treatment. The smooth aligner surface ensures a comfortable fit, minimizing any discomfort or soreness often associated with braces.

When it comes to effectiveness, Invisalign has been proven to correct a wide range of orthodontic issues, including overcrowded teeth, gaps between teeth, overbite, underbite, and crossbite. However, it’s important to note that each individual case is unique, and the success of Invisalign treatment depends on various factors, such as the severity of the misalignment and patient compliance.

Exploring Traditional Braces

If you’re considering orthodontic treatment to straighten your teeth and improve your smile, traditional braces are a tried and true option that can provide excellent results. Let’s dive into what traditional braces are, their advantages, and their effectiveness.

Traditional braces consist of metal brackets that are bonded to the teeth and connected by wires and tiny elastic bands. They work by applying gentle pressure to gradually shift the teeth into their desired positions. The orthodontist will periodically adjust the wires to ensure steady progress throughout the treatment.

One of the key advantages of traditional braces is their versatility. They can correct a wide range of dental issues, including overcrowding, gaps between teeth, overbites, underbites, and crossbites. Traditional braces are highly effective in straightening teeth and achieving a properly aligned bite, which can improve overall oral health.

Furthermore, traditional braces are known for their reliability. Once the brackets are placed on the teeth, they remain in position until the treatment is complete, ensuring consistent pressure is applied to facilitate tooth movement. This reliability makes traditional braces a popular choice among both orthodontists and patients.

When it comes to effectiveness, traditional braces have a proven track record of success. With regular adjustments and proper oral hygiene, patients can expect to see noticeable improvements in their smile over time. The duration of treatment varies depending on individual cases, but most patients wear braces for an average of 18 to 24 months.

Comparing: Braces vs Aligners

When it comes to orthodontic treatment, two popular options are Invisalign and braces. Both methods can effectively straighten teeth and improve oral health, but they differ in several aspects.

Differences in Treatment Process: Invisalign uses a series of clear aligners made from smooth and comfortable plastic, while braces consist of metal brackets and wires. Invisalign aligners are custom-made to fit snugly over your teeth and gradually shift them into place. Braces, on the other hand, use brackets bonded to the teeth and connected by wires that apply gentle pressure to move the teeth. The treatment process for Invisalign involves changing aligners every one to two weeks, while braces typically require adjustments and tightening every few weeks.

Aesthetics and Comfort: One significant advantage of Invisalign is its virtually invisible appearance. The clear aligners are hardly noticeable, allowing you to maintain a natural smile throughout the treatment. Braces, although effective, are more noticeable due to their metal components. Invisalign aligners are also removable, making it easier to eat, drink, and clean your teeth without any restrictions. Braces, being fixed to the teeth, require certain dietary restrictions and extra care while cleaning.

Maintenance and Oral Hygiene: Invisalign aligners are easy to clean and maintain. Simply remove them when eating or drinking (except for water) and brush your teeth as usual. Cleaning braces, on the other hand, requires more effort as food particles can get stuck in the brackets and wires. Specialized tools like interdental brushes and floss threaders may be needed to ensure thorough cleaning.

Factors to Consider in Your Decision

When deciding between Invisalign and braces, there are several factors to consider that can help you make an informed decision. These factors include treatment duration and complexity, cost and insurance coverage, and orthodontic specialist recommendation.

Treatment duration and complexity: One important consideration is how long and complex your orthodontic treatment needs may be. Invisalign is known for its convenience and shorter treatment time compared to traditional braces. While braces typically require a longer treatment period, they are often recommended for more complex cases that may require significant tooth movement.

Cost and insurance coverage: Financial considerations play a vital role in any decision-making process. Invisalign treatment tends to be slightly more expensive than braces, but the cost can vary depending on factors such as the severity of your case and your location. It’s important to check with your insurance provider to determine coverage for both options.

Orthodontic specialist recommendation: Seeking advice from an orthodontic specialist is crucial in determining the most suitable treatment for your specific needs. They can assess your oral health, dental history, and provide expert guidance on the best course of action.
